Gas Limit: The Backbone of Ethereum Transactions
Before we dive deeper, let’s unravel the concept of the gas limit. In Ethereum, gas is a unit of measurement for the computational work required to execute transactions and smart contracts. Each transaction consumes a certain amount of gas, and the gas limit defines the maximum amount of gas that can be used for a transaction. Traditionally, the gas limit has been a fixed value, but this approach has its limitations, especially as the network grows.

Ethereum’s Current Gas Limit Structure
Ethereum’s gas system is designed to measure and incentivize the computational effort required to execute transactions and smart contracts. Each block has a predefined gas limit, and transactions are included in blocks until this limit is reached. The gas price, determined by users, incentivizes miners to include their transactions in a block. However, as the network grows, the gas limit often becomes a bottleneck.
